See Central Park from a pedicab rickshaw on a relaxed 1-hour ride focused on the lower and mid loop. Choose from two pickup spots near Columbus Circle or The Plaza Hotel and make 3–4 optional stops for photos.
A minimum of 2 people per booking is required. Arrive 5–10 minutes before your scheduled tour time.
Full refund with at least 24 hours notice of cancellation. Full refund in case of operator cancellation. No-shows will be charged the full price. Services run rain or shine.
Yes. Book with a minimum of 2 people per booking.
Dress light in spring and summer. Wear layers in fall and winter; a jacket or coat, plus a hat and gloves, is recommended in colder months.
Bring your camera for photo opportunities in Central Park.
